I forgot to mention in the video that you have to keep your hand inside that handle or you can hurt your finger against the trigger which is all metal. Be sure and show the kids how to pump it without getting their finger caught. I got bit and it hurt. 

Also the receiver that is gold is actually very shiny plastic. It keeps its shine and everything but I also forgot to mention that it's not metal. Obviously a lot of parts are metal including the trigger but that gold is not metal.

I have one of these also, it shoots so well I purchased a second. My son uses the second for BBS only, but I installed a red fiber optic in the front post and it shoots lights out ragged groups at 20 yards using JSB 8.4 or 10.3 gr.
